February 27, 2020—KB4535996 (OS Builds 18362.693 and 18363.693)

https://support.microsoft.com/en-us/help/4535996/windows-10-update-kb4535996

Highlights

Updates an issue that prevents the speech platform application from opening for several minutes in a high noise environment.

Updates an issue that reduces the image quality in the Windows Mixed Reality (WMR) home environment.

Updates an issue that might prevent ActiveX content from loading.

Improves the battery performance during Modern Standby mode.

Updates an issue that causes Microsoft Narrator to stop working when a user session is longer than 30 minutes.

Addresses an issue that adds an unwanted keyboard layout as the default after an upgrade even if you have already removed it.

Updates an issue that prevents the Windows Search box from rendering properly.

Updates an issue that prevents the printer settings user interface from displaying properly.

Updates an issue that prevents some applications from printing to network printers.

KB4052623 Update for Windows Defender antimalware platform

https://support.microsoft.com/en-us/help/4052623/update-for-windows-defender-antimalware-platform

This package includes monthly updates and fixes to the Windows Defender antimalware platform that is used by Windows Defender Antivirus in Windows 10.

Monthly updates are installed in addition to major Windows 10 releases. Both types of updates should be installed to ensure continued protection against malware and other threats.
